I find myself having the hardest time planning December's trip because we won't be using the dining plan.

We've gotten accustomed to planning our days around food. Now, we are back to planning our days and adding in food. We decided not to do the dining plan in December due to cost....With tips and the plan itself, it would cost us almost $800.

I don't spend that much on groceries in a two month period, yet alone for 5 days of meals. I almost caved in and told my DH we would buy the plan in December last night after sitting at the table for an hour and not having a dining schedule set. He reminded me that we really need to take budget trips this year so we can pay down debt and add to the savings account. The dining plan will still be there once we have some other things paid off and can comfortably spend a bit more on vacations.
